and initiatives), implemented analytical procedures on the quantitative information, checked the calculation and consolidation of the data on the basis of spot checks, and ascertained that they were coherent and consistent with the other informationprovidedin the managementreport; at the level of a representativesample of entities selected by a us (2) on the basis of their activity, their contribution to the consolidated indicators, their location and a risk analysis, we conducted interviews to verify that procedures are properly applied, and we performed tests of details, using sampling techniques,in order to verify the calculationsand reconcilethe data with the supporting documents. The sample selected in this way represented69%of staff between23% and 100%of the other quantitativeinformationpublished. For the remainingconsolidatedESR Information,we assessedits consistencybasedon our understandingof the company. Finally, we have assessed the relevance of the related explanations, where applicable, regarding the total or partial absenceof certain information. We believe that the sampling methods and the size of the samples chosen by us while exercising our professional judgementallowus to expressa conclusionof limitedassurance; a higher level of assurancewould have requiredmore extensive work. Due to the use of sampling techniques and other limitations inherent to information and internal control systems, the risk of not detecting a material misstatement in the CSR Informationcannotbe totallyeliminated. Conclusion Based on our work, we did not observe any significant misstatement likely to call into question the fact that the ESR Information,taken as a whole, is presented in a fair manner, in accordancewith the Standard.
ON THE FAIRNESS OF THE ESR INFORMATION
Nature and scope of the work We held meetings with six individuals responsiblefor preparing the CSR Information at the departments in charge of gathering the information, and where applicable, with the individuals responsible for the internal control and risk management procedures,in order to: assess the appropriate nature of the Standard in terms of its a relevance, completeness, reliability, objectivity, and comprehensiblenature, taking best practices in the sector into consideration,whereapplicable; ascertain that an information-gathering, compilation, a processingand control process had been implemented,with a view to the completenessand consistencyof the Information, and familiarize ourselves with the internal control and risk managementproceduresrelatingto the preparationof the ESR Information. We determinedthe nature and extent of our checks and controls in accordance with the nature and significance of the CSR Information, in view of the company’s specific features, the social and environmental challenges posed by its business activities, its sustainable development strategy and of best practicesin the sector. Regarding the ESR Information that we considered to be the most important (1) : at the level of the consolidating entity, we consulted the a documentary sources, and held meetings in order to corroborate the qualitative information (organization, policies
